diff options
author | Gerrit Renker <gerrit@erg.abdn.ac.uk> | 2008-04-14 09:05:09 +0200 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2008-04-14 09:05:09 +0200 |
commit | 7de6c033367ab86f39c7723392caf73325cbf286 (patch) | |
tree | e05d84e6e02b7a0245bfa62e02835882ffdffa48 /include/net | |
parent | [SKB]: __skb_queue_after(prev) = __skb_insert(prev, prev->next) (diff) | |
download | linux-7de6c033367ab86f39c7723392caf73325cbf286.tar.xz linux-7de6c033367ab86f39c7723392caf73325cbf286.zip |
[SKB]: __skb_append = __skb_queue_after
This expresses __skb_append in terms of __skb_queue_after, exploiting that
__skb_append(old, new, list) = __skb_queue_after(list, old, new).
Signed-off-by: Gerrit Renker <gerrit@erg.abdn.ac.uk>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include/net')
-rw-r--r-- | include/net/tcp.h |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/include/net/tcp.h b/include/net/tcp.h index 58d82822414d..2ab350eca02e 100644 --- a/include/net/tcp.h +++ b/include/net/tcp.h @@ -1247,7 +1247,7 @@ static inline void tcp_insert_write_queue_after(struct sk_buff *skb, struct sk_buff *buff, struct sock *sk) { - __skb_append(skb, buff, &sk->sk_write_queue); + __skb_queue_after(&sk->sk_write_queue, skb, buff); } /* Insert skb between prev and next on the write queue of sk. */ |